Things to Do around Seaham

Seaham, a coastal town in County Durham, is characterized by its dramatic clifftops, wild beaches, and historical pathways. The region forms part of the Durham Heritage Coast, offering a landscape shaped by both natural processes and its industrial past. This unique environment provides varied terrain suitable for several sports like hiking, jogging, touring cycling, road cycling, and more. Former railway lines and coastal paths offer diverse routes, from open sea views to sheltered woodland sections.

What are the best hiking trails in Seaham?

Seaham is known for its coastal walks along the Durham Heritage Coast, featuring dramatic cliffs and beaches. Popular options include the Seaham Seafront & Hawthorn Dene Woods loop, a moderate 7.0-mile (11.3 km) path. The Durham Heritage Coast – Blast Beach loop is another 4.5-mile (7.2 km) trail exploring the area's industrial heritage. More hiking suggestions are available in the Hiking around Seaham guide.

What cycling routes are available in Seaham?

Seaham features over 20 miles (34 km) of cycle-friendly routes, blending coastal paths with quieter inland trails. Cyclists can join National Cycle Network Route 1 from Seaham Harbour. The Murton Loop offers a moderate circuit through varied terrain. Find more options in the Cycling around Seaham guide.

What are the main attractions or viewpoints in Seaham?

Seaham's highlights include the dramatic Durham Heritage Coast with its clifftop views and beaches. Hawthorn Dene, a designated nature reserve, offers picturesque woodland sections. The 'Tommy' WWI statue is a notable cultural landmark along the coastal path, providing a poignant point of interest.
